flapping between port
necesito ver como resolver el flapping que se produce en un par de switch 3750 en statck, tengo un server SUn conectado en ambos equipos con las tarjetas de red enm modo virtual y se produce el siguiente log en el switch:
SW_MATM-4-MACFLAP_NOTIF: Host 0014.4f3e.b02e in vlan 9 is flapping between port Gi1/0/7 and port Gi2/0/7.
los port estan bien asignados a la vlan 9 el la configuracion de spannig tree es la siguiente:
spanning-tree mode pvst
spanning-tree etherchannel guard misconfig
spanning-tree extend system-id
spanning-tree vlan 1-2,9,248 priority 0.
como puedo mejorar esto , pasa por la configuracion de spanning tree o es un problema de la configuracion dela tarjeta de red del server.
gracias hap
